Output 53a56257b93c31896dc4cceab7f7c98d593de94a1f86967846045eec67069eb6:0

value
134087
script pubkey
OP_0 OP_PUSHBYTES_20 f55a5ec831b0ab9868e67bf5754710da35aaedaa
address
bc1q74d9ajp3kz4es68x006h23csmg664md2w0ngta
transaction
53a56257b93c31896dc4cceab7f7c98d593de94a1f86967846045eec67069eb6